Subject: Cron-to-Windmere cut-over summary

Hello plugin authors — as of this morning, all scheduled jobs on the Larkspur platform have been migrated from host-level cron to the Windmere workflow engine. Legacy crontabs have been disabled but preserved for thirty days. Plugins registering scheduled tasks must now declare them via the Windmere manifest; direct cron registration will be rejected. The engine settings your plugins will run under are the following.

settings of kahag-bagug:
[quenath]
port = 6379
region = outer-2
host = quenath.nelvrocorp.internal
timeout_ms = 2000
retries = 3

## Session Handling for Health Checks

The Corvel gateway sits behind the Lanternside load balancer, which probes /healthz every ten seconds. Health-check requests are stateless by design: they bypass the session store entirely so that probe traffic never inflates session counts or evicts real user sessions. New team members should note that the deep-check endpoint, /healthz/deep, does verify session-store connectivity and therefore requires authentication. When probing it manually, supply the token below.

bearer token for tajep-kajef: eyJhbGciOiJIUzI1NiIsInR5cCI6IkpXVCJ9.eyJzdWIiOiIoOsZ23In0.CsygO0hs

# Artifact Signing — FareSplit Pricing Experiment

All plugins targeting the FareSplit ticket-pricing experiment must ship signed artifacts. Unsigned bundles are rejected at upload. Sign with your vendor key, then countersign against the experiment channel. The Quellan registry verifies both layers before the plugin can touch pricing variants. Rotation happens quarterly; stale signatures fail closed. No exceptions for hotfixes. External authors: test against the staging verifier first. The current experiment channel verification key follows.

signing key of bagap-yawep = bky13_TbfT6ZMUoGJo2